Transaction 34a702c341ddb7ea9485f60c501e8fe6c069fbca06a452a985b41c6428f1a125
1 Input
1 Output
-
34a702c341ddb7ea9485f60c501e8fe6c069fbca06a452a985b41c6428f1a125:0
- value
- 579774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b63ba13187676c96f781abdb4d6e36d7aaca9ecd OP_EQUAL
- address
- 3JJaLbfQX6bwagnSffCgGkVG8JuBwHf1e8